Struct raw_cpuid::ProcessorTopologyInfo

source ·
pub struct ProcessorTopologyInfo {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

Processor Topology Information (LEAF=0x8000_001E).

§Platforms

✅ AMD ❌ Intel

Implementations§

source§

impl ProcessorTopologyInfo

source

pub fn x2apic_id(&self) -> u32

x2APIC ID

source

pub fn core_id(&self) -> u8

Core ID

§Note

Core ID means Compute Unit ID if AMD Family 15h-16h Processors.

source

pub fn threads_per_core(&self) -> u8

Threads per core

§Note

Threads per Core means Cores per Compute Unit if AMD Family 15h-16h Processors.

source

pub fn node_id(&self) -> u8

Node ID

source

pub fn nodes_per_processor(&self) -> u8

Nodes per processor
